Postman 开源项目指南
项目介绍
Postman 是一个广泛使用的API开发和测试工具,但请注意,您提供的链接指向的是一个特定用户的仓库(https://github.com/aaronpowell/Postman.git),而非官方Postman项目。该用户可能贡献了有关Postman的自定义脚本或扩展功能。由于这个仓库的具体内容没有详细说明,我们将基于假设它提供了某项Postman的定制化使用或示例来构建本文档框架。真正的Postman官方项目是在 getpostman/postman-app-support 这样的仓库中。
核心特性
- API测试自动化:支持多种HTTP请求。
- 集合管理:组织和分享API请求。
- 环境变量:适应不同部署环境。
- 预处理器和断言:增强测试逻辑。
项目快速启动
假设aaronpowell/Postman
包含了一个示例集合或脚本,以下是快速使用步骤:
-
克隆项目
git clone https://github.com/aaronpowell/Postman.git
-
安装Postman应用程序
如果尚未安装,从 Postman官网 下载并安装Postman。 -
导入示例集合
- 打开Postman应用。
- 点击侧边栏的“导入”按钮。
- 选择刚克隆项目中的
.json
文件(假设项目中包含一个Postman集合)进行上传。
-
运行第一个请求
- 导入后,在集合视图中选择一个请求。
- 设置必要的环境变量(如果有提供)。
- 点击“发送”,查看响应。
应用案例和最佳实践
- API开发周期:利用Postman来设计、测试你的API端点。确保每个功能按预期工作。
- 团队协作:共享集合给团队成员,实现测试和文档的一致性。
- 自动化测试脚本:创建预处理器和断言,以确保API行为的一致性和可靠性。
示例情景
- 假设集合中有“获取用户信息”的请求,最佳实践包括设置正确的请求头,如
Content-Type: application/json
,并在响应中使用断言检查用户名是否正确。
典型生态项目
由于直接关联的仓库未明确其具体贡献于Postman生态的哪一部分,我们通常认为Postman生态系统包括但不限于:
- 自动化测试框架集成(如 Newman for CI/CD 流程)。
- 第三方插件和脚本,提高工作效率。
- API文档生成工具,与Postman集合同步。
注意:对于具体的aaronpowell/Postman
仓库内容,实际使用前应阅读其README文件了解详细使用方法和目的,这里仅提供一个通用的指导思路。